Video: Crystal Palace winger Olise arrives in Munich to undergo medical with Bayern
Published: July 07, 2024
Crystal Palace winger Michael Olise has left France's Olympic national team training camp in order to complete a move to German Bundesliga giants Bayern Munich.
In a video uploaded on X by transfer market expert Fabrizio Romano, the 2021 Super Eagles invitee was seen entering a red car after his arrival at the VIP terminal of Munich Airport
Bayern Munich have pulled off a transfer coup with the imminent signing of the France U23 international, beating the likes of Chelsea, Manchester City and Manchester United to his services.
The €51 million release clause set by Crystal Palace for Olise will be paid by Bayern, with potential bonus payments of up to €5 million based on his performance.
If the quad-national player passes his medical with flying colours, he will put pen to paper on a five-year contract as a new Bayern Munich player.
Bayern were keen to sign Olise as they see him as the ideal winger to provide competition for Kingsley Coman and Serge Gnabry
Given that he will be playing for the French team in the Olympics from July 24 to August 10, it is unlikely he will take part in Bayern's pre-season preparations.
A product of the Chelsea and Reading academies, Olise is set to depart Crystal Palace after registering 41 goals (16 goals, 25 assists) in 90 all-competition appearances.
